Oswego Man Identified As Victim of Mexico Crash

UPDATED: The Oswego County Sheriff’s Office says 51-year-old Michael J. Fredette of Oswego was pronounced dead at University Upstate Hospital on March 26 following a rollover crash in Mexico Saturday evening. The driver, 51-year-old Douglas B. Horton of Mexico, was arrested for driving while intoxicated, deputies said.

Mary West Earns Cross Country Academic Award

The U.S. Track & Field and Cross Country Coaches Association announced its annual All-Academic Team award and Rensselaer Polytechnic Student student-athlete Mary West was among the award winners. To earn that distinction, student-athletes must have a cumulative GPA of 3.30 or higher and finish in the top 25 percent at their respective regional.
